BS4020 Final Year Project or BS4021 Bi-Semestral Final Year Project.
Students who opted for BS4020 Final Year Project (full semester) are not allowed to read any course in the particular semester.
Students who opted for BS4021 Bi-Semestral FYP are allowed to read 3 courses (9 AU) in each semester. BS4021 Bi-Semestral FYP must start in Year 4 Sem 1.

Second Major in Future Foods

 

Compulsory Core Courses: 15 AU
Second Major Electives: Minimum 15 AU
Total: Minimum 30 AU

5 COMPULSORY COURSES (15 AU)

Course CodeCourse TitleAUYear / Sem
CM5101Food Chemistry & Nutrition3Year 2 / Sem 1
CH5220Food Standard – Food Safety & Risk Assessment3Year 2 / Sem 2
CH5222Future Foods – Introduction to Advanced Meat Alternatives3Year 4 / Sem 2
CH5211Data Analytics in Food Systems3Year 4 / Sem 2
CH5210Food Process Technologies and New Production Systems3Year 4 / Sem 1
Total15
